How much do learning and development j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 18, 2026, the average hourly pay for learning and development in Macon, GA is $39.21,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.98 and $66.63 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is learning and development (L&D)?

Learning and development (L&D) refers to the process within organizations that focuses on improving employees’ skills, knowledge, and competencies. L&D involves designing, delivering, and evaluating training programs, workshops, and other educational activities to help employees perform better in their current roles and prepare for future responsibilities. The goal is to foster professional growth, enhance job satisfaction, and contribute to organizational success. L&D can include onboarding, technical training, leadership development, and ongoing education tailored to business needs.

How does a Learning and Development professional typically collaborate with other departments to identify training needs?

Learning and Development professionals often work closely with managers and team leads across various departments to assess skill gaps and align training initiatives with organizational goals. This collaboration usually involves conducting needs assessments, gathering feedback through surveys or interviews, and reviewing performance data to design targeted programs. Effective communication and relationship-building skills are essential, as L&D professionals must balance the needs of different teams while ensuring training solutions are practical and impactful.
